Mr. Derek M.
Smashey, CFA MBA, is a Co-Portfolio Manager at Scout Investments, Inc. He is responsible for Mid Cap Equity Strategy.
He has over 18 years of financial industry experience.
Prior to joining Scout Investments in 2006, Mr. Smashey was a director at Nations Media Partners, an investment banking firm specializing in media and communications.
He earned his MBA from the University of Kansas and his Bachelor of Science degree in Finance from Northwest Missouri State University.
He is a CFA charterholder and a member of the CFA Society Kansas City, as well as the CFA Institute.

Scout Investments, Inc. Investment ManagersFinance Scout Investments, Inc. (Scout) is a SEC-registered investment advisor head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ri. The firm is a wholly-owned subsidiary of Carillon Tower Advisers, Inc., itself a subsidiary of Raymond James Financial, Inc. (NYSE: RJF). Founded in 2001, Scout provides discretionary investment management services to registered and unregistered investment companies, institutional accounts and individuals through separately managed accounts.
